Faucet & Fixture Questions
Most standard faucet replacements take about 1–2 hours, depending on access and existing plumbing conditions.
Yes. As long as the faucet is compatible with your sink and plumbing configuration, installation is straightforward.
Faulty shutoff valves are common in older homes. They can usually be replaced during the same visit if needed.
Minor issues like worn cartridges or loose handles can often be repaired. If the faucet body is corroded, leaking at the base, or outdated, replacement is usually the more practical long-term solution.
